Designing well-crafted, pleasing, and useful pieces of furniture Designing a piece of furniture should be fun. Yet woodworkers who think nothing of building a complicated jig or mastering a difficult finish feel lost when it comes to designing a piece of furniture. The articles in this book will help you understand the basics of designing for both form and function and learn approaches to planning your designs for successful construction.

In this book you’ll discover: Design inspiration - from Shaker to Arts & Crafts The four objectives of furniture design Drafting basics and how to create working drawings How to choose the best construction methods for your designs Models that help projects succeed Tips for designing graduated drawers, legs and aprons, doors Design strategies for coffee tables, sideboards, chests of drawers THE NEW BEST OF FINE WOODWORKING series collects classic articles from the last 10 years of Fine Woodworking magazine (published between 1992 and 2002). Organized by topic, fully indexed, these books make it easy to access the best woodworking ideas and information straight from the experts. Softcover, 8-1/2 x 10-7/8 in., 160 pages, with color photos and drawings Published 2004, ISBN 1-56158-684-6, # 070767
